引言:虚拟币钱包的重要性
随着区块链技术的发展,虚拟币逐渐融入我们的生活。人们开始购买、交易和投资各种虚拟币,而虚拟币钱包则成为了每一个数字资产持有者的必需品。虚拟币钱包不仅用于存储加密货币,还涉及到安全性、用户便捷性及功能多样性等多个方面。
一、虚拟币钱包的基本功能
无论是简单的钱包应用还是复杂的系统,虚拟币钱包都应该具有以下基本功能:
- 资金存储:确保用户可以安心存储他们的虚拟币。
- 收发功能:用户应能够方便地接收和发送虚拟币。
- 交易记录:记录每一笔交易,确保透明性和追溯性。
- 多种虚拟币支持:支持多种主流加密货币,例如比特币、以太坊等。
二、选择PHP作为开发语言的理由
PHP是一种广泛使用的开源脚本语言,适用于web开发。使用PHP开发虚拟币钱包的优势包括:
- 易于学习和使用:PHP的语法相对简单,即便是初学者也能上手。
- 丰富的社区支持:PHP有一个庞大的开发者社区,可以获得大量的资源和支持。
- 强大的数据库支持:PHP与多种数据库系统兼容,可以方便地管理用户数据。
三、虚拟币钱包的安全性保障
安全性是虚拟币钱包的重中之重。下面是一些关键的安全措施:
- 数据加密:所有用户数据和交易信息应进行加密存储,避免数据泄露。
- 两步验证:实施两步验证(2FA),进一步增加账户安全。
- 定期安全检查:定期对软件进行测试,识别潜在的安全漏洞。
四、开发PHP虚拟币钱包的步骤
在开始开发之前,我们需要明确开发步骤:
- 需求分析:明确定义用户需求,决定钱包的功能和目标用户群体。
- 系统架构设计:设计合理的架构,确保系统在安全性、扩展性和易维护性方面都达到预期。
- 数据库设计:创建合理的数据库结构,存储用户信息、交易记录等。
- 开发与测试:进行编码和测试,确保每个功能正常的运行。
- 部署上线:将钱包应用部署到服务器,进行上线前的最终检查。
五、PHP虚拟币钱包的功能拓展
除了基本功能,开发者可以考虑以下额外功能来增强用户体验:
- 多语言支持:使钱包可以支持多种语言,增加用户范围。
- 用户界面:设计直观的用户界面,提升用户交互体验。
- 实时行情查看:提供虚拟币行情的实时更新,帮助用户做出决策。
六、案例分析:成功的PHP虚拟币钱包
分析一些成功的虚拟币钱包案例,可以提供更深的理解。比如:
- Coinbase:界面简洁,功能强大,支持多种加密货币,是一个不错的参考。它通过简单的注册流程吸引用户,并提供良好的学习资料。
- Blockchain.info:用户反馈良好,已经成为许多用户的首选钱包。该钱包专注于保障用户资产安全,并提供实时交易数据。
七、总结:成功打造PHP虚拟币钱包的关键
开发一个成功的PHP虚拟币钱包并不容易,但通过注重安全性、用户体验和功能多样性,可以提高用户的满意度与粘性。有效的市场推广策略和持续的技术更新也是成功的长远保障。希望通过本文的介绍,能为那些希望开发自己的虚拟币钱包的开发者们提供一些有用的参考。
如上所述,正确的结构、内容丰富和深入的讨论,不仅能够解决用户痛点,还可以提升文章在搜索引擎中的排名。希望这篇文章能为开发者带来指导,让更多人成功开发出优质的虚拟币钱包。